HACK vs. FTXL
Compare and contrast key facts about ETFMG Prime Cyber Security ETF (HACK) and First Trust Nasdaq Semiconductor ETF (FTXL).
HACK and FTXL are both exchange-traded funds (ETFs), meaning they are traded on stock exchanges and can be bought and sold throughout the day. HACK is a passively managed fund by ETFMG that tracks the performance of the Prime Cyber Defense Index. It was launched on Nov 11, 2014. FTXL is a passively managed fund by First Trust that tracks the performance of the Nasdaq U.S. Smart Semiconductor Index. It was launched on Sep 20, 2016. Both HACK and FTXL are passive ETFs, meaning that they are not actively managed but aim to replicate the performance of the underlying index as closely as possible.

Correlation
The correlation between HACK and FTXL is 0.63, which is considered to be moderate. This suggests that the two assets have some degree of positive relationship in their price movements. Moderate correlation can be acceptable for portfolio diversification, offering a balance between risk and potential returns.
